Ingredients
Lime Yogurt Dressing
1 ½cupslow-fat plain yogurt
1tablespoonlime zest
1tablespoonlime juice
4teaspoonsgranulated sugar
Green Fruit Salad
4cupsdiced ripe honeydew melon
1cuphalved seedless green grapes
1cuppeeled, sliced and quartered ripe kiwi (about 2)
2tablespoonschopped fresh mint (Optional)
1cupLime Yogurt Dressing (optional)

Directions
To prepare Lime Yogurt Dressing: Combine yogurt, lime zest, lime juice and sugar in a medium bowl.To prepare Green Fruit Salad: Combine melon, grapes, kiwi and mint (if using) in a large bowl. Serve with yogurt dressing, if desired.To make aheadRefrigerate for up to 4 hours; toss with mint just before serving, if using. Refrigerate Lime Yogurt Dressing for up to 1 day.
To prepare Lime Yogurt Dressing: Combine yogurt, lime zest, lime juice and sugar in a medium bowl.
To prepare Green Fruit Salad: Combine melon, grapes, kiwi and mint (if using) in a large bowl. Serve with yogurt dressing, if desired.
To make ahead
Refrigerate for up to 4 hours; toss with mint just before serving, if using. Refrigerate Lime Yogurt Dressing for up to 1 day.
